Valentine's day is coming soon. St. Valentine is a third century saint of whom little is known. In the 14th century his feast day, February 14th, became associated with courtly or romantic love. Jean-Honoré Fragonard painted a lovely picture called "The Love Letter" that can inspire us to write tender affection to our dear ones.
